Standout Feature

Luminate Platform's cognitive AI for autonomous supply chain planning and execution

Blue Yonder provides an end-to-end supply chain management platform powered by AI and machine learning, optimizing demand forecasting, inventory management, warehouse operations, transportation, and fulfillment. It delivers real-time visibility, predictive analytics, and autonomous decision-making to enhance agility and resilience across global supply chains. Trusted by thousands of enterprises, the platform integrates seamlessly with ERP systems and helps reduce costs while improving service levels.

Standout Feature

Concurrent planning engine that simulates and optimizes the entire supply chain in real-time simultaneously

Kinaxis RapidResponse is a cloud-based supply chain orchestration platform that delivers concurrent planning across demand, supply, inventory, and logistics for end-to-end visibility and control. It enables real-time scenario simulation, risk assessment, and automated responses to disruptions using AI-driven analytics. The solution integrates seamlessly with ERP systems and supports collaborative decision-making for complex, global operations.

Standout Feature

SAP Integrated Business Planning (IBP) for real-time, multi-dimensional planning across demand, supply, inventory, and sales & operations.

SAP Supply Chain Management (SCM) is an enterprise-grade suite of applications that provides end-to-end visibility and control over supply chain operations, including planning, sourcing, manufacturing, logistics, and delivery. It integrates seamlessly with SAP's ERP systems like S/4HANA, leveraging AI, machine learning, and real-time analytics for demand forecasting, inventory optimization, and transportation management. Designed for complex global supply chains, it enables collaborative planning and execution across partners and stakeholders.

Standout Feature

AI-powered Active Intelligence for real-time, autonomous supply chain orchestration and optimization

Manhattan Active Supply Chain Management is a cloud-native, SaaS-based platform that delivers end-to-end supply chain execution, including warehouse management (WMS), transportation management (TMS), inventory optimization, and order management systems (OMS). It utilizes AI, machine learning, and microservices architecture to enable real-time visibility, automation, and adaptive decision-making across complex supply chains. The solution supports omnichannel fulfillment and scales seamlessly for high-volume operations.

Standout Feature

Copilot AI for predictive planning and automated supply chain orchestration

Microsoft Dynamics 365 Supply Chain Management is a cloud-based ERP solution that streamlines end-to-end supply chain processes, including demand planning, procurement, manufacturing, inventory control, warehouse management, and transportation. It leverages AI, IoT, and real-time analytics to provide visibility, optimize operations, and enhance resilience across global supply chains. Deeply integrated with the Microsoft ecosystem, including Power BI, Azure, and Copilot, it supports data-driven decision-making and automation at scale.

Standout Feature

Micro-vertical industry templates and Hook & Loop configuration engine for rapid, code-free customization to specific business processes

Infor Supply Chain Management is a robust, cloud-based suite that optimizes end-to-end supply chain operations, including planning, procurement, manufacturing, warehousing, transportation, and execution. It leverages AI-driven analytics, IoT integration, and advanced forecasting to enhance visibility, efficiency, and decision-making across complex supply networks. Tailored for industries like manufacturing, distribution, healthcare, and food & beverage, it integrates deeply with Infor's ERP CloudSuites for seamless data flow.
